Intergenerational Family Mediation for Social Workers

This course on intergenerational family mediation is designed to provide specialized training for social workers and other professionals who work with the elderly and their family caregivers. The course includes advanced training in mediation processes and consensus-building for families considering guardianship and alternatives such as continuous power of attorney and supported decision-making (SDM). The course also introduces mediation methods for families coping with a wide range of conflicts and issues associated with aging such as wills and inheritance, elderly treatment and care, medical and financial issues, planning for advanced age, strengthening family relationships, improving relations with caregivers and relevant institutions, dividing responsibilities of care, and more.
